Product Overview

The Gigabyte GeForce RTX 4060 Ti Aero OC operates on NVIDIA's cutting-edge Ada GPU architecture, which introduces structural improvements in memory bandwidth optimization, tensor core efficiency, and power distribution. The card features a 128-bit memory interface with 8GB of GDDR6 memory clocked at 18 Gbps, delivering 288 GB/s of memory bandwidth. The Aero OC variant includes factory overclocking with a boost clock of 2655 MHz, providing out-of-the-box performance gains over the reference design. The triple-fan Windforce cooling system utilizes composite copper heat pipes and aluminum fin stacks to maintain optimal thermal performance under sustained loads, with temperatures typically remaining below 70 degrees Celsius during gaming workloads.

What distinguishes the Aero OC model is its intelligent power management through dual 8-pin PCIe connectors, supporting a 130W TDP with excellent power efficiency. The card incorporates Gigabyte's proprietary thermal design with semi-passive cooling that stops fan rotation during idle or light loads, reducing noise and power consumption. Hardware-accelerated ray tracing cores and tensor cores enable DLSS 3 technology with frame generation, effectively doubling frame rates in supported titles. The compact 2.5-slot design makes it compatible with most mid-tower cases while maintaining excellent airflow characteristics, and the full-height bracket ensures compatibility with standard PC chassis configurations.

How to Use

Installation begins by powering down your system and disconnecting the power supply, then opening your PC chassis and locating a PCIe 4.0 x8 slot (the card operates at x8 bandwidth, though x16 slots are compatible). Align the Gigabyte RTX 4060 Ti with the slot and apply firm, even pressure until the retention clip engages with an audible click, ensuring the card is fully seated. Connect the dual 8-pin PCIe power connectors from your power supply to the card's connectors, ensuring secure connections to prevent power delivery issues. Install the included mounting bracket using the provided screws, then close your chassis and reconnect the power supply.

After physical installation, boot your system and download the latest NVIDIA GeForce drivers from the official NVIDIA website or Gigabyte's support page. Install the drivers and restart your system to enable full GPU functionality. Configure display outputs by connecting your monitor to the HDMI 2.1 or DisplayPort 1.4a connectors on the card (not the motherboard). In your GPU control panel, enable DLSS 3 in supported games and configure power settings for optimal performance or power efficiency based on your workload requirements. For overclocking, use Gigabyte's RGB Fusion software or MSI Afterburner to incrementally increase GPU and memory clocks while monitoring temperatures, testing stability after each adjustment with 3DMark or FurMark benchmarks.

Frequently Asked Questions

What is the difference between RTX 4060 Ti and RTX 4070 for gaming performance?

The RTX 4060 Ti delivers approximately 70-75% of the RTX 4070's performance due to fewer CUDA cores (2560 vs 5888) and reduced memory bandwidth (288 vs 576 GB/s). For 1440p gaming, the 4060 Ti achieves 60+ fps with ray tracing and DLSS 3, while the 4070 targets 4K gaming. The 4060 Ti consumes 130W versus 200W, making it more power-efficient for mid-range builds with 650W PSUs, whereas the 4070 requires robust 750W+ power supplies.

Is 8GB VRAM sufficient for modern gaming and content creation?

For 1440p gaming, 8GB is adequate for all current titles with high settings, though some ultra-settings scenarios with maximum texture resolution may cause minor stuttering. For 4K gaming, 12GB or 16GB is recommended. In content creation, 8GB is limiting for complex 3D scenes with millions of polygons or high-resolution video editing above 4K, where 12GB minimum is preferred. VRAM requirements depend on scene complexity and texture resolution rather than absolute limits.

Does the RTX 4060 Ti support NVIDIA CUDA acceleration for professional software?

Yes, the RTX 4060 Ti fully supports CUDA compute with 2560 CUDA cores, providing acceleration in professional software like DaVinci Resolve, Blender, Adobe Creative Suite, and ANSYS. However, it lacks specialized tensor cores for AI workloads compared to professional RTX series cards, and professional driver support is limited. For professional workflows, consider RTX 4500 or RTX 6000 Ada cards, though the 4060 Ti remains viable for small-scale professional tasks with acceptable performance trade-offs.

What power supply wattage is required for the RTX 4060 Ti Aero OC?

NVIDIA officially recommends a 650W power supply for systems with RTX 4060 Ti, accounting for CPU and motherboard power draw. The card itself consumes maximum 130W at full load. For stable operation with mid-range processors like Ryzen 5 7600X or Intel i5-13600K, a quality 650W PSU with 80+ Bronze certification is sufficient. For high-end CPUs like Ryzen 9 7950X, upgrade to 750W to ensure stable power delivery under combined CPU and GPU load, particularly if planning overclocking.
